PLEASE READ THESE GROUND RULES FOR THIS SUNDAY'S EVENT:
- The gates will open at 10:00 am, and there is absolutely no incentive to get there before then - there's no "first 100" giveaways, no early-bird specials, no nothing. All you'll be doing by getting there early is wasting your own time and giving Irwindale PD extra time to look for reasons to give you a ticket.
- PETS ARE NOT ALLOWED. PERIOD.
- Entrance is from Live Oak Ave.
- Raffle tickets will be given to registrants who drive their Lexus vehicles to the meet. No Lexus = No raffle ticket.
- If you plan on drag racing your vehicle, please read and familiarize yourself with the Toyota Speedway Drag Rules. All racers will be subject to these rules, and must pass tech inspection in order to be eligible to race.
- Sales of ANY KIND are prohibited on the racetrack grounds. Anyone caught conducting business of any kind will be immediately asked to leave by race track security.
- While in the display/parking area, speeding, revving, and burnouts are STRICTLY PROHIBITED. Anyone caught doing this will be immediately asked to leave by race track security.
- We have consulted with CHP and Irwindale local law enforcement, and they are aware of this event. When arriving/departing, please obey rules of the road. CHP will be on the lookout for displays of excessive speed on the convoys and streets around the race track.
